In addition, they can help to protect you against threats of retaliation by your employer for filing a work-related accident claim. In many cases, employers attempt to punish injured employees for filing an injury claim, by demotioning or firing them, reducing their hours, or requiring employees to return to work early.

They can also help you receive the maximum amount of benefits for workers' compensation that your state law requires.  workers' compensation lawsuit fairfield  cover wage replacement, vocational rehabilitation, medical costs as well as other expenses that result from an employee's workplace injuries.

But, while these benefits can be crucial in a financial crisis, they are not always enough. Workers' compensation attorneys can also pursue third-party claims to boost the value of a workers' claim.

These claims can result in fiveor six-, even seven-figure sums. They can be made against third parties, such as subcontractors, contractors, vendors, delivery drivers and suppliers.

Workers compensation is a kind of insurance coverage that guarantees that injured or sick workers who suffer injuries or medical conditions that are caused by workplace accidents. Workers agree to not sue their employers for negligence in civil court in exchange for these benefits.

If you do have an appropriate claim, your employer or its insurance company will try to fight it. They have lawyers who can minimize your workers' compensation benefits. They'll pressure you to accept a small settlement that doesn't cover any lost wages or outstanding medical bills.

It can be challenging to win workers' compensation cases, especially if the injury is severe or persistent. The insurance company may try to limit your benefits to avoid having to pay large medical bills and treatment expenses. They could also deny your claim.

Timeframe

It is essential to know the timeframe for receiving workers' compensation benefits if you have been injured while working. Getting help from an experienced NYC workers' compensation lawyer early enough can make the process go more smoothly.

It is important to begin the workers compensation process by submitting a report to your employer within 10 days of an accident at work. This is the form C-2 (Employer’s Report of Work-Related Injuries).

Once you've filed the report The Workers' Compensation Board will have already received information about your injury at the time they receive it. The Workers' Compensation Board will then look over the report to determine if you're eligible for benefits and the amount you can receive.

After you've been approved for benefits the insurance company will begin paying you every two weeks until you reach Maximum Medical Improvement (MMI) and are unable to return to work in the same level or when the benefits period ends. It usually takes between 18 and 29 days in the majority of cases.
